Web" The Raven " is a narrative poem by American writer Edgar Allan Poe. First published in January 1845, the poem is often noted for its musicality, stylized language, and supernatural atmosphere. It tells of a distraught lover who is paid a mysterious visit by a talking raven. WebThe Poetic Principle. " The Poetic Principle " is an essay by Edgar Allan Poe, written near the end of his life and published posthumously in 1850, the year after his death.
